Overall, owners tend to find the Honda HR‑V a practical, reliable and economical compact SUV that’s easy to live with in town and for family duties, offering predictable handling and a comfortable ride. Common positives include good fuel economy, roomy/intuive packaging and reassuring manners; common negatives some owners mention are noticeable noise under brisk acceleration or low‑speed maneuvers and a tendency to feel underpowered on sustained highway runs. So while feedback is broadly favorable for city and everyday use, opinions are more mixed on long‑distance refinement — worth a motorway run during your test drive if that’s your regular terrain.

Costs and Efficiency:

Looking at overall running costs, both models reveal some interesting differences in everyday economy.

Dacia Duster is considerably cheaper – starting at 16,300 £ , while the Honda HR-V costs 29,700 £ . That’s a price difference of around 13,465 £.

Fuel consumption also shows a difference: the Dacia Duster uses 4.7 L/100km and is slightly more efficient than the Honda HR-V with 5.4 L/100km. The difference is about 0.7 L/100km.

Engine and Performance:

Under the bonnet, it becomes clear which model is tuned for sportiness and which one takes the lead when you hit the accelerator.

When it comes to engine power, the Dacia Duster offers slightly more power – delivering 158 HP compared to 131 HP. That’s roughly 27 HP more horsepower.

When accelerating from 0 to 100 km/h, the Dacia Duster is slightly quicker – completing the sprint in 9.4 s, while the Honda HR-V takes 10.6 s. That’s about 1.2 s quicker.

There’s also a difference in torque: the Honda HR-V delivers marginally more torque with 253 Nm compared to 230 Nm. That’s about 23 Nm more.

Space and Everyday Use:

Beyond pure performance, interior space and usability matter most in daily life. This is where you see which car is more practical and versatile.

Both vehicles offer seating for 5 people.

In terms of curb weight, Dacia Duster is marginally lighter – 1,377 kg compared to 1,452 kg. The difference is around 75 kg.

Looking at boot space, the Dacia Duster offers markedly more boot space – 517 L compared to 319 L. That’s a difference of about 198 L.

When it comes to payload, the Dacia Duster carries only slightly more – 453 kg compared to 418 kg. That’s a difference of about 35 kg.
